The Official biggest songs of 2024 so far

POS TITLE ARTIST PEAK
1 STICK SEASON NOAH KAHAN 1
2 LOSE CONTROL TEDDY SWIMS 2
3 BEAUTIFUL THINGS BENSON BOONE 1
4 ESPRESSO SABRINA CARPENTER 1
5 TOO SWEET HOZIER 1
6 TEXAS HOLD 'EM BEYONCE 1
7 PRADA CASSO/RAYE/D-BLOCK EUROPE 2
8 MURDER ON THE DANCEFLOOR SOPHIE ELLIS-BEXTOR 2
9 CRUEL SUMMER TAYLOR SWIFT 2
10 GREEDY TATE MCRAE 3
11 LOVIN ON ME JACK HARLOW 1
12 END OF BEGINNING DJO 4
13 AUSTIN DASHA 7
14 A BAR SONG (TIPSY) SHABOOZEY 3
15 I LIKE THE WAY YOU KISS ME ARTEMAS 3
16 YES AND ARIANA GRANDE 2
17 FORTNIGHT TAYLOR SWIFT FT POST MALONE 1
18 SCARED TO START MICHAEL MARCAGI 9
19 WE CAN'T BE FRIENDS (WAIT FOR YOUR LOVE) ARIANA GRANDE 2
20 UNWRITTEN NATASHA BEDINGFIELD 6
21 ALIBI ELLA HENDERSON FT RUDIMENTAL 10
22 HOUDINI DUA LIPA 2
23 WATER TYLA 4
24 STRANGERS KENYA GRACE 1
25 VAMPIRE OLIVIA RODRIGO 1
26 MR BRIGHTSIDE KILLERS 10
27 PRAISE JAH IN THE MOONLIGHT YG MARLEY 5
28 I REMEMBER EVERYTHING ZACH BRYAN FT KACEY MUSGRAVES 14
29 ASKING SONNY FODERA/MK/DOUGLAS 7
30 MILLION DOLLAR BABY TOMMY RICHMAN 3
31 TRAINING SEASON DUA LIPA 4
32 BELONG TOGETHER MARK AMBOR 11
33 RIPTIDE VANCE JOY 10
34 DNA (LOVING YOU) BILLY GILLIES FT HANNAH BOLEYN 9
35 FLOWERS MILEY CYRUS 1
36 I HAD SOME HELP POST MALONE/MORGAN WALLEN 2
37 WHATEVER KYGO & AVA MAX 15
38 EVERYWHERE FLEETWOOD MAC 15
39 ANTI-HERO TAYLOR SWIFT 1
40 WHAT WAS I MADE FOR BILLIE EILISH 1

The lack of recurrent rules on the UK Charts makes their lists so unserious. Fair enough for "Murder On The Dancefloor" and "Unwritten" which got legit resurgences, but "Mr. Brightside" and especially Fleetwood Mac's "Everywhere" have no business being here.

 

I know the UK Charts, unlike Billboard, only wants to reflect the best selling songs on a given year, but for those who appreciate Year-End lists as highlighting the biggest hit songs of any given year this is beyond inconvenient.
